<strong>Texas</strong> Food Fact: The Spoetzl Brewery in Shiner was founded in 1909,<br />

making it the oldest independent brewery in <strong>Texas</strong>. Their premier brand,<br />

Shiner Bock, is popular nationwide.<br />
